Report: New PSN Message Glitch Can Freeze and Lock Your PS4 (Update #2)

Update #2:

The official PlayStation Spain Twitter account tweeted that Sony has acknowledged the PS4 messaging issue, and are working on a fix.

ResetEra user kennyamr has posted a workaround that should work.

If one of those messages are sent to you, just turn off the console.
Take the phone app and erase the message.
Then press down the power button for 7 seconds to make the PS4 go into Safe Mode.
Finally proceed to Rebuild the Database to fix the problem. (This is not factory reset, nothing will be erased).
Of course, after all that, report the dummy account to Sony.

Others say that removing the message from the phone app is enough to fix the problem, but there are some conflicting reports on this.

I guess you can try just removing the message with your phone and wait a few minutes first.

Original Story:

While it’s never OK to spread rumors and panic among people, this one is a special case. It seems there’s a new PSN message glitch spreading now that’s bricking PS4s! Nope, this isn’t a joke.

This was posted by Reddit user Huntstark who mentioned that this happened to him and his friends, with the only way to fix it was via a factory reset.

Just the other day, another user on Reddit also mentioned the same thing happening. User Pindabaas mentioned he received a PM (private message) from someone with two symbols on it, and the console froze, and gave a CE_36329-3 error.

What’s more, Pindabaas used another account and sent those same symbols and yep, it froze again, confirming that the PM was the cause of the console malfunction.

On Sony’s official website, the CE-36329-3 PS4 error code means “An error has occurred with the system software.” The fix suggested is the following:

An error has occurred with system software

  1. Follow the on-screen instructions and select [Report Problem].
  2. Make sure that you have the latest version of the System Software installed by selecting [Settings] > [System Software Update].  The system should then be restarted.
  3. If you have upgraded the Hard Disk Drive (HDD) in your system, please re-install the original HDD.
  4. If the error occurs again, back up your saved data, and then go to [Settings] > [Initialization] and choose [Initialize PS4].
  5. If the error continues and occurs with every application, or as soon as the application starts, please contact PlayStation Support.

The only main way to stop this now is to set your messages to “private” so not anyone can mesasge you randomly.

We’ve contacted Sony about this and will update the story if and when we get a response.
